About Tacy Holliday, PhD, Pmp, Cissp

Tacy Holliday, PhD, PMP, CISSP, serves as the Director of EPMO & Compliance at AIS and has been an Adjunct Professor at the University of Maryland Global Campus since 2016. With a strong educational background in public administration, psychology, and leadership, she focuses on integrating human and machine learning to foster high-performing cultures.

Education and Expertise

Tacy Holliday holds multiple degrees, showcasing her extensive educational background. She earned a Doctor of Philosophy in Psychology from Walden University (2006-2009) and a Master of Science in Psychology from the same institution (2005-2006). Additionally, she obtained a Master of Public Administration from American Military University (2015-2017). Holliday also completed a Bachelor of Science in Psychology at the University of Maryland Global Campus (2003-2004) and holds two Associate degrees from Montgomery College in General Studies (2001-2003) and Environmental Science (2010). She has furthered her education with leadership studies at Cornell University in 2014.
